Common Sidewalk Concrete Repair Jobs
Sidewalk Repair - restoring uneven or cracked concrete for safe pedestrian use.
Crack Filling - sealing small to large cracks to prevent further damage.
Slab Replacement - removing and replacing severely damaged sections of sidewalk.
Leveling Services - correcting uneven surfaces caused by settling or ground shifts.
Expansion Joint Repair - fixing or replacing joints to control cracking and movement.
Surface Resurfacing - applying new finishes to improve appearance and durability.
Sidewalk Concrete Repair Questions
What types of sidewalk damage can be repaired? Common issues like cracks, uneven surfaces, and spalling can be addressed through repair services to restore safety and appearance.
Is sidewalk repair necessary for safety? Yes, repairing cracks and uneven areas helps prevent tripping hazards and maintains a safe walking surface.
What are signs that a sidewalk needs repair? Visible cracks, shifting slabs, and surface deterioration are indicators that repair may be needed to prevent further damage.
How does repair improve sidewalk longevity? Repairs reinforce the concrete, prevent further cracking, and extend the lifespan of the sidewalk for years to come.
